Indonesia, Malaysia and the Philippines against Abu Sayyaf

MANILA — Indonesia, Malaysia and the Philippines on Monday (June 20) agreed to designate a transit corridor for commercial vessels crossing a maritime zone hit by a spate of hijackings by Islamist militants in the southern Philippines.
